PGM电子图,格式、用途及应用解析pg电子图

PGM电子图,格式、用途及应用解析pg电子图,

本文目录导读:

  1. PGM电子图的基本概念
  2. PGM电子图的格式特点
  3. PGM电子图的用途
  4. PGM电子图的优缺点
  5. PGM电子图的未来发展趋势

在现代电子设计和图形处理领域,PGM(Portable Gray Map)作为一种重要的电子图格式,广泛应用于多个行业,包括电子设计自动化(EDA)、游戏开发、医学成像等领域,本文将深入解析PGM电子图的格式、特点、用途及其在实际应用中的优势和挑战,帮助读者全面理解PGM电子图的价值和应用范围。

PGM电子图的基本概念

PGM(Portable Gray Map)是一种无色灰度位图电子图格式,主要用于表示灰度级的图像数据,与彩色图像相比,PGM文件中每个像素仅包含亮度信息,没有颜色通道,这种格式在存储空间上相对较小,适合在资源受限的设备上使用,同时也能在不同分辨率下保持图像质量。

PGM文件的结构

PGM文件由以下几个部分组成:

  1. 头信息(Header):包含文件的尺寸、位数、颜色深度和压缩类型等元数据。
  2. 数据部分(Data):包含图像的像素值,通常以二进制形式存储。
  3. 尾信息(Trailer):包含文件的大小、 CRC校验码等信息。

PGM文件的格式由两部分组成:PGM头信息和像素数据,PGM头信息通常以ASCII编码形式存储,而像素数据则以二进制形式存储。

PGM电子图的格式特点

PGM电子图的格式特点主要体现在以下几个方面:

  1. 无色灰度:PGM文件仅存储亮度信息,没有颜色通道,因此无法表示彩色图像。
  2. 压缩方式:PGM文件通常采用LZW压缩算法进行压缩,以减少文件大小。
  3. 无色深度:PGM文件的色深为8位,即每个像素可以表示256种灰度级别。

PGM电子图的用途

PGM电子图因其无色灰度的特点和较小的文件大小,广泛应用于以下几个领域:

电子设计自动化(EDA)

在EDA领域,PGM电子图常用于芯片设计和布局,由于PGM文件的无色灰度特性,能够清晰地表示芯片的导电层和连接线路,PGM文件的压缩特性也使得设计工具在处理大规模芯片设计时更加高效。

游戏开发

在游戏开发中,PGM电子图常用于表示游戏场景的灰度图像,由于PGM文件的无色灰度特性,能够很好地表示阴影、光照和深度信息,PGM文件的压缩特性也使得游戏开发团队能够在有限的存储空间内存储大量游戏图像。

医学成像

在医学成像领域,PGM电子图常用于表示X光、CT和MRI等灰度图像,由于PGM文件的无色灰度特性,能够清晰地表示组织密度和骨骼结构,PGM文件的压缩特性也使得医学图像在传输和存储时更加高效。

地理信息系统(GIS)

在GIS领域,PGM电子图常用于表示地形高度和地物分布,由于PGM文件的无色灰度特性,能够清晰地表示地形的起伏和地物的分布情况,PGM文件的压缩特性也使得GIS数据在传输和存储时更加高效。

PGM电子图的优缺点

优点

  1. 文件大小小:由于PGM文件采用LZW压缩算法,文件大小通常在几KB到几十KB之间,适合在资源受限的设备上使用。
  2. 无色深度:PGM文件的无色深度为8位,能够表示256种灰度级别,适合表示灰度图像。
  3. 兼容性好:PGM文件格式广泛兼容,可以在不同操作系统和设备上使用。
  4. 编辑工具支持:许多图形编辑工具支持PGM文件格式,方便用户对图像进行编辑和处理。

缺点

  1. 无色灰度限制:由于PGM文件仅存储亮度信息,无法表示彩色图像,限制了其应用范围。
  2. 压缩算法复杂:PGM文件采用LZW压缩算法,虽然压缩效果好,但解压过程较为复杂。
  3. 无色深度限制:PGM文件的无色深度为8位,无法表示更高的色深,限制了其表现力。

PGM电子图的未来发展趋势

随着电子技术的不断发展,PGM电子图的格式和应用也在不断优化,PGM电子图可能会更加注重以下几点:

  1. 高色深支持:通过增加色深,PGM文件能够表示更多的颜色信息,从而更好地支持彩色图像。
  2. 无损压缩:通过改进压缩算法,PGM文件的压缩率和解压速度将得到进一步提升。
  3. 多格式兼容:PGM文件格式将更加注重与其他格式的兼容性,以满足更多应用的需求。

PGM电子图作为一种无色灰度位图电子图格式,因其无色深度、压缩特性以及良好的兼容性,广泛应用于电子设计、游戏开发、医学成像和GIS等领域,尽管PGM文件的无色灰度限制了其表现力,但其压缩特性使其在资源受限的环境中仍然具有重要价值,PGM电子图将通过高色深支持、无损压缩和多格式兼容等技术,进一步提升其应用范围和表现力。

PGM电子图,格式、用途及应用解析pg电子图,

发表评论